Understanding Cuba Visa Requirements

Before you book your flights to Cuba, it’s essential to understand the visa requirements. As a U.S. citizen, you can travel to Cuba under specific categories like family visits, educational activities, or support for the Cuban people. Most travelers will need a tourist card, which acts as your visa for the duration of your stay.

Here are some key points regarding the Cuba visa:

  • Tourist Card: Generally valid for 30 days, extendable for another 30 days.
  • Purchase: Available through airlines, travel agencies, or Cuban embassies.
  • Documentation: Ensure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your planned departure date.

The Easiest Airline to Cuba for Visa Access

When considering your travel plans, choosing the right airline services can significantly influence the ease of obtaining your Cuba visa. American Airlines stands out as one of the best options for U.S. travelers. Not only does it offer a variety of flights to Cuba, but it also provides a convenient way to acquire your tourist card.

American Airlines allows you to purchase your tourist card directly when you book your flight online or at the airport. This integration simplifies the process, making it easier for travelers who may not be familiar with the visa application process. Additionally, the airline provides detailed information about the necessary documentation and requirements, which is invaluable for first-time visitors.

Cuba Travel Tips for a Smooth Experience

Once your visa is sorted out, it’s time to prepare for your journey. Here are some essential Cuba travel tips that can enhance your experience:

  • Currency Exchange: Cuba has two currencies: the Cuban Peso (CUP) and the Cuban Convertible Peso (CUC). Make sure to familiarize yourself with the exchange rates.
  • Internet Access: Wi-Fi is limited, and you’ll need to purchase a Wi-Fi card for access in designated areas.
  • Health Insurance: Proof of health insurance is required upon arrival. Ensure your plan covers medical services in Cuba.
  • Transportation: Taxis and private transport are common; consider pre-arranging your airport transfer for ease.

Travel Restrictions and Considerations

Travel to Cuba has unique travel restrictions, particularly for U.S. citizens. It’s vital to stay updated on these regulations, as they can change frequently. Here are some considerations:

  • Travel Categories: Ensure you travel under one of the approved categories as per U.S. regulations.
  • Documentation: Keep all necessary documents, including your visa, travel insurance, and proof of accommodation, handy during your trip.
